Japan Lithium-Ion Battery Separator Membrane Market By Type Segment Analysis
The Japan lithium-ion battery separator membrane market is classified primarily into microporous polyolefin membranes, ceramic-coated membranes, and composite membranes. Among these, microporous polyolefin membranes—comprising polyethylene (PE) and polypropylene (PP)—dominate due to their proven thermal stability, chemical resistance, and cost-effectiveness. Ceramic-coated membranes, offering enhanced thermal stability and safety features, are gaining traction as safety standards tighten, while composite membranes—integrating multiple materials for tailored performance—are emerging as innovative solutions for high-performance applications. Market size estimates suggest that microporous polyolefin membranes account for approximately 70% of the total market, valued at around USD 1.4 billion in 2023, with ceramic-coated and composite membranes collectively comprising the remaining 30%. The fastest-growing segment within this landscape is ceramic-coated membranes, driven by increasing safety regulations and demand for high-temperature resilience. This segment is projected to grow at a CAGR of approximately 12% over the next five years, outpacing traditional polyolefin membranes, which are expected to grow at a more moderate rate of 4-6%. The maturity stage varies, with microporous polyolefin membranes reaching a mature, saturated phase, while ceramic-coated and composite membranes are in the emerging to growing stages, benefitting from technological advancements and stricter safety standards. Innovations in membrane manufacturing, such as nanostructured coatings and composite layering, are significantly impacting performance, safety, and lifespan, further fueling market expansion. The increasing adoption of electric vehicles (EVs) and energy storage systems (ESS) is a key growth accelerator, demanding safer, more durable separator membranes that can withstand higher operational stresses.

Japan Lithium-Ion Battery Separator Membrane Market By Application Segment Analysis
The application landscape for lithium-ion battery separator membranes in Japan is primarily segmented into electric vehicles (EVs), consumer electronics, energy storage systems (ESS), and industrial applications. Among these, EVs represent the largest and fastest-growing segment, driven by Japan’s aggressive push towards electrification and stringent emission regulations. The EV segment is estimated to account for over 50% of the total separator membrane market in 2023, with a market size approaching USD 1.2 billion. Consumer electronics, including smartphones and laptops, remains a significant segment, though its growth rate has plateaued due to market saturation. ESS applications are rapidly expanding, propelled by Japan’s national energy policies promoting renewable integration and grid stabilization, with an estimated CAGR of 10-12% over the next five years. The industrial segment, including power tools and backup power supplies, maintains steady demand but is relatively mature. The growth stage varies across segments: EV and ESS are in the emerging to growing phases, characterized by technological innovation and increasing adoption, whereas consumer electronics are approaching saturation. Key growth drivers include advancements in battery chemistry, safety standards, and the proliferation of EV charging infrastructure. Innovations such as solid-state and high-capacity batteries are demanding separator membranes with enhanced thermal stability, chemical resistance, and lifespan, thus accelerating technological development in membrane materials. The rising importance of safety and performance in high-energy-density batteries is a critical factor shaping future market dynamics.
